Having a mental illness can be disabling, but I want to share my story to show you that you can get better from an OCD disorder.

My obsessive thoughts are mainly focused around "getting sick" or "having panic attacks" and present if I don't follow particular patterns. For example, even though I was 100% sure that stepping on a crack wouldn't make me sick, my OCD led me to believe that it would.

It may not seem logical, but it feels so so real! At times I felt like my OCD disorder gave me the feeling of being in control, control over my mental health especially when I was anxious.

That's why the healing process can be very tricky, so I really hope my journey inspires you to overcome your OCD disorder. ๐Ÿงก
